A relay is an electrical switch that uses an electromagnet to control another circuit. Relays have been used for over 100 years and are found in a wide variety of applications, from simple on/off switches to complex control systems. Wiring a relay is a relatively simple process, but it is important to understand the basics of relay operation before getting started.

The most important thing to understand about relays is that they are essentially switches. When the coil of the relay is energized, the contacts of the relay will close, allowing current to flow through the circuit. When the coil is de-energized, the contacts will open, interrupting the flow of current. The type of contacts used in a relay will determine the type of circuit that can be controlled. For example, single-pole, single-throw (SPST) contacts can be used to control a simple on/off switch, while double-pole, double-throw (DPDT) contacts can be used to control more complex circuits.

Wiring diagrams are visual representations of electrical systems, providing a roadmap for understanding how components are connected and interact. They are essential tools for electricians, engineers, and anyone working with electrical systems, enabling them to troubleshoot problems, design new circuits, and maintain existing ones. Wiring diagrams use a standardized set of symbols and conventions to represent electrical components and their connections, making them universally understandable.

The ability to read wiring diagrams is crucial for electrical professionals, as it allows them to safely and efficiently work with electrical systems. Wiring diagrams provide a visual representation of the system, making it easier to identify potential problems and plan repairs or modifications. They also serve as a valuable communication tool, allowing different stakeholders to collaborate effectively on electrical projects.
